Diskussion:Splint (Software)

aus Wikipedia, der freien Enzyklopädie
Letzter Kommentar: vor 12 Jahren von Uncopy in Abschnitt Korrektes Programm ist nicht korrekt
Zur Navigation springen Zur Suche springen

Korrektes Programm ist nicht korrekt

[Quelltext bearbeiten]

Im C Standart ist nicht festgehalten, dass die Bedingungen in einer While-Schleife von links nach rechts ausgewertet werden müssen. So kann es sein, dass c != EOF geprüft wird, bevor es eingelesen wird! "Korrekt" wäre, wenn es VOR der Schleife eingelesen wird (und natürlich in der Schleife)! (nicht signierter Beitrag von 85.220.141.242 (Diskussion) Diskussion:Splint (Software)#c-85.220.141.242-2012-01-10T12:59:00.000Z-Korrektes Programm ist nicht korrekt11) Beantworten

Möglicherweise hast du das Komma für ein logisches Und gehalten. Für mich sieht es schon korrekt aus - auch wenn ich es mit Sicherheit anders schreiben würde. Grüße --Uncopy Diskussion:Splint (Software)#c-Uncopy-2012-01-11T11:49:00.000Z-85.220.141.242-2012-01-10T12:59:00.000Z11Beantworten